    Jackson submits plan to fix Thalia Mara Hall fire code violations

    JACKSON, Miss. ( WJTV ) – The City of Jackson submitted an action plan to fix issues that were discovered during a State Fire Marshal inspection at Thalia Mara Hall earlier this month.

    According to the report by the State Fire Marshal’s Office (SFMO), mold was found in the facility, and human waste was found on the balcony. The report also found that some fire extinguishers were not up to date.

    City aims to correct Thalia Mara Hall fire code violations

    In early August, the city was forced to close Thalia Mara Hall after “early microbial activity” was discovered following a recent malfunction with the HVAC controller in the facility.

    Jackson leaders said their action plan includes replacing extension cords, repairing the fire alarm system, updating the fire extinguishers, and replacing missing ceiling tiles. They said mold remediation services are being scheduled, and sanitation staff has been assigned to clean the area were human waste was found.

    “The City of Jackson has responded to the SFMO with a plan of action to fix these issues in a timely manner. The State Fire Marshal’s Office is committed to working with City of Jackson officials to resolve this matter as quickly as possible while protecting the health and safety of the public,” Chaney said.

    Jackson officials said they will continue to coordinate with the necessary contractors and internal staff to ensure the issues are addressed.
